The Abwasserzweckverband Untere Ahr (AZV UA) plans to build a new wastewater treatment plant, Untere Ahr, in Remagen, following the severe damage to the existing plant in Sinzig during the 2021 flood disaster. The site selected for the new plant is north of the B 266, on a plot approximately 7-8 m higher than the old site, making it flood-proof. The project is currently in the design and approval planning phase (Phase 3/4-HOAI). Following the submission of the building application in April 2026, preparatory work for the construction of the wastewater treatment plant in Remagen is scheduled to begin in 2026. Only a pumping station will remain at the old site in Sinzig. For this, consulting, conceptual, and possibly construction-related engineering services in the field of construction logistics by a technically qualified engineering firm are required. The following service description, which is requested here, is necessary for the technically optimal implementation of the construction measure and the legally compliant handling of the topic of construction logistics and is of extraordinary importance for the project's success. It is intended to award the following service description in three stages. Execution times: - Stage 1: immediately after the order, probably September 2026, - Stage 2: beginning of the 1st quarter 2027, - Stage 3: beginning of the 2nd quarter 2027 to end of 4th quarter 2031.
